Reds Sign Dustin Hermanson
RotoWorld is reporting that the Reds signed 34 year-old reliever Dustin Hermanson to add to their stable of low-velocity veterans in the pen. Hermanson's magical 34 save fluke season for the '05 world champs could earn him some save opps with the Reds when his back allows him to pitch (fantasy alert!) Jerry Narron called him a "bona fide closer" earlier this month.
Past reports showed all sorts of teams (Phillies, D-Rays, Yankees) passing on Hermanson after reviewing his medical records or watching him pitch.
